
Jack Pope contributed to core front-end infrastructure across facebook/relay, microsoft/react-native-macos, facebook/react-native, and facebook/flow, focusing on type safety, test reliability, and feature enablement. He enhanced React Native’s Fabric rendering by improving type definitions and enabling intersection observer support, using JavaScript and TypeScript to ensure safer attribute handling. In facebook/relay, Jack stabilized resource synchronization and introduced experimental hooks with robust test scaffolding, leveraging React and state management best practices. He also updated Flow’s React type definitions for React 19+, aligning with new APIs and reducing upgrade risk. His work demonstrated depth in configuration management, testing, and cross-repository consistency.

Month 2025-10: Focused on updating Flow's React type definitions to align with React 19+ and introduce support for new APIs, ensuring safer upgrades for downstream apps and maintaining compatibility with evolving React APIs.
Month 2025-10: Focused on updating Flow's React type definitions to align with React 19+ and introduce support for new APIs, ensuring safer upgrades for downstream apps and maintaining compatibility with evolving React APIs.
July 2025 monthly summary for facebook/react-native. Delivered two feature enhancements focused on type safety and Fabric rendering capabilities, with added tests to improve reliability and cross-module interoperability. The work emphasizes business value through reduced integration friction, safer attribute handling, and stronger observer support in Fabric.
July 2025 monthly summary for facebook/react-native. Delivered two feature enhancements focused on type safety and Fabric rendering capabilities, with added tests to improve reliability and cross-module interoperability. The work emphasizes business value through reduced integration friction, safer attribute handling, and stronger observer support in Fabric.
February 2025: Focused on stabilizing test coverage for the macOS Fabric path by re-enabling the enableFabricCompleteRootInCommitPhase flag in the testing environment. This backout of a prior cleanup restored consistent test behavior and maintained alignment between test expectations and the FabricCompleteRoot feature flag, enabling reliable regression checks in CI for microsoft/react-native-macos.
February 2025: Focused on stabilizing test coverage for the macOS Fabric path by re-enabling the enableFabricCompleteRootInCommitPhase flag in the testing environment. This backout of a prior cleanup restored consistent test behavior and maintained alignment between test expectations and the FabricCompleteRoot feature flag, enabling reliable regression checks in CI for microsoft/react-native-macos.
January 2025 monthly summary focused on stabilizing resource update flow in React components within facebook/relay. Delivered a high-impact bug fix that ensures useResourceEffect checks for missed updates in both the create and update phases, reducing stale state and improving synchronization across UI components. No new features were released this month; the work prioritizes reliability and developer confidence.
January 2025 monthly summary focused on stabilizing resource update flow in React components within facebook/relay. Delivered a high-impact bug fix that ensures useResourceEffect checks for missed updates in both the create and update phases, reducing stale state and improving synchronization across UI components. No new features were released this month; the work prioritizes reliability and developer confidence.
Summary for 2024-12: Focused on delivering foundational platform capabilities in Relay and performance improvements through a React ecosystem upgrade, with emphasis on feature-flag experimentation support and robust test scaffolding to enable safe iteration.
Summary for 2024-12: Focused on delivering foundational platform capabilities in Relay and performance improvements through a React ecosystem upgrade, with emphasis on feature-flag experimentation support and robust test scaffolding to enable safe iteration.
November 2024 monthly summary focusing on business value and technical achievements across two repositories. Key improvements include code quality enforcement for React Native macOS and test reliability enhancements for Relay, delivering maintainability, reduced risk, and stronger test signals across critical code paths.
November 2024 monthly summary focusing on business value and technical achievements across two repositories. Key improvements include code quality enforcement for React Native macOS and test reliability enhancements for Relay, delivering maintainability, reduced risk, and stronger test signals across critical code paths.
Overview of all repositories you've contributed to across your timeline